Output c17938823aad1f8ae198aa17e2c6a9a8aa1a2f73cf437a86ef026d5a4c16eb76:5

value
557750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d58adab784d6822fc69a80539f9c77ead1955c8 OP_EQUAL
address
32uawX9gKFpijDfRFtJSbx72K6XA7A7CyN
transaction
c17938823aad1f8ae198aa17e2c6a9a8aa1a2f73cf437a86ef026d5a4c16eb76
confirmations
277986
spent
true